Hallo, ich erzeuge eine .txt-Datei in die eine Variable mit Wert geschrieben wird.
In der .txt-Datei steht nun z.b: $datenbank = "wib091107";
Wenn ich die Datei nun im nächsten Skript einbinde
gibt er im Browser $datenbank = "wib091107"; aus.
Warum macht er das. Wenn ich die Variable in einem anderen Skript definiere und per include() einbinde gehts doch auch so wie es gehen muß.
MfG Simauki
PHP-Code:
if (!isset($_REQUEST[datenbank]) or empty($_REQUEST[datenbank]))
{echo "<p><br><br><br>Es wurde kein Spielstand ausgewählt. Bitte wählen Sie einen vorhandenen Spielstand aus.
<br><br><a href=auswertungindex.php>Spielstand auswählen</a>";}
else {$formular = '$datenbank = "'.$_REQUEST[datenbank].'";';
$fp = fopen("auswertung.txt", "w-");
$ok = fwrite($fp, $formular);
if (!ok)
{echo "<p><br><br><br>Spielstand konnte nicht geöffnet werden. Bitte versuchen Sie es erneut.
<br><br><a href=auswertungindex.php>Spielstand auswählen</a>";}
else {echo "<p><br><br><br>Spielstand wurde ausgewählt.<br><br><a href=auswertung2.php>Auswertung starten</a>";}
@fclose($fp);}
unset ($_REQUEST[datenbank]);
Wenn ich die Datei nun im nächsten Skript einbinde
PHP-Code:
include 'auswertung.txt';
echo $datenbank;
Warum macht er das. Wenn ich die Variable in einem anderen Skript definiere und per include() einbinde gehts doch auch so wie es gehen muß.
MfG Simauki
Kommentar